技术文摘
PHP 搜索引擎优化中 Algolia 的优势与不足
在 PHP 搜索引擎优化领域,Algolia 作为一款强大的工具,有着诸多显著优势,同时也存在一些不可忽视的不足。深入了解这些方面,有助于开发者更好地运用 Algolia 提升网站的搜索性能与用户体验。
Algolia 的优势首先体现在其强大的搜索功能上。它具备高度精准的搜索算法,能够快速且准确地匹配用户输入的关键词,为用户提供最相关的搜索结果。在处理大规模数据时,Algolia 依然能保持高效,这对于 PHP 构建的大型网站而言至关重要。比如电商类网站,拥有海量的商品数据,Algolia 能迅速定位到用户想要的产品,极大提升用户查找商品的效率,进而增加用户对网站的好感度与停留时间。
Algolia 的灵活性令人称赞。它支持多种数据格式,能够轻松与 PHP 应用集成。无论是简单的博客系统还是复杂的企业级应用,都能通过 Algolia 的 API 快速实现搜索功能的定制化开发。而且,它提供丰富的配置选项,开发者可以根据具体业务需求对搜索结果的排序、筛选等进行灵活设置。
Algolia 的用户体验优化做得相当出色。它提供即时搜索建议功能,在用户输入关键词的过程中,就实时展示可能的搜索词,引导用户更准确地表达需求。搜索结果的呈现形式多样且美观,能吸引用户点击。
然而,Algolia 也并非十全十美。成本是其一大不足,对于一些预算有限的小型项目来说,Algolia 的付费计划可能会带来一定的经济压力。另外,虽然 Algolia 功能强大,但对于技术能力较弱的开发者而言,其复杂的配置和 API 可能存在一定的学习成本,在集成过程中可能会遇到困难。而且,Algolia 依赖外部服务,如果其服务器出现故障或者网络不稳定,将会直接影响到网站的搜索功能,对用户体验造成负面影响。
在 PHP 搜索引擎优化中,Algolia 凭借其优势为开发者提供了强大助力,但不足也需要开发者谨慎权衡,根据项目实际情况合理选择与运用。
- Flex DataGrid单元格背景色设置的全程跟踪
- Eclipse系统中Flex插件的安装与配置
- Flex测试工具RIATest Beta版正式发布
- 后SOA时代 普元聚焦IT架构与开发管理统一平台
- Flex弹出窗口的用法剖析
- Flex弹出窗口用法的详尽解读
- Flex常见控件用法解析
- FlexBuilder3.0携手Eclipse3.4
- 专家提醒FlexaddChild()方法使用注意事项
- Flex内存泄露问题剖析及解决方法详述
- jQuery最佳实践之精妙自定义事件
- Flex内存优化技巧集合技术分享发布
- Flex性能优化基本原则解读
- Flex去除XML中\n换行符的专家解答
- Flex正则表达式常见用法剖析